Choosing the Right Property

When it comes to buy-to-let investments, selecting the right property is crucial. Location, demand, and potential for growth are key factors to consider. Urban areas with strong rental demand, such as London, Manchester, and Birmingham, are often attractive options. Additionally, it is important to assess the property’s condition, local amenities, and proximity to transportation links. Conduct thorough research and consult with property experts to make an informed decision.

Understanding Legal Obligations

Operating as a landlord in the UK requires a thorough understanding of legal obligations and compliance regulations. From gas safety checks to deposit protection, landlords must adhere to a multitude of legal requirements. Failure to do so can result in hefty fines or legal disputes. Stay up-to-date with the latest regulations, consult legal professionals, and consider joining reputable landlord associations for guidance and support.

Minimizing Risks and Maximizing Returns

While the buy-to-let market offers attractive opportunities, it is not without risks. Fluctuating property prices, void periods, and maintenance costs can impact your investment returns. To mitigate these risks, conduct regular property inspections, invest in appropriate insurance coverage, and maintain a financial buffer for unexpected expenses. Additionally, keeping your property in good condition and providing excellent tenant service can help reduce void periods and attract reliable, long-term tenants.

What is NAP SEO?

NAP SEO refers to the practice of optimizing your business’s Name, Address, and Phone Number across the web to improve local search engine rankings. It involves making sure that your NAP information is consistent and accurate on your website, online directories, social media profiles, and other platforms where your business is mentioned. Search engines like Google use NAP information as a key factor in determining which businesses to display in local search results. When your NAP details are consistent across various online platforms, it increases the chances of ranking higher in local search results.

Why NAP SEO is Important

  • Improves Local Search Rankings: Search engines consider NAP consistency when determining the credibility of a business. If your NAP information matches across multiple platforms, it sends a signal to search engines that your business is legitimate and trustworthy. This can improve your chances of appearing in local search results and the local “3-pack” (the top three results shown on Google Maps).
  • Enhances User Experience: Accurate NAP information makes it easier for potential customers to find your business. When users search for your business online, having consistent contact details helps them reach you without confusion. If there are discrepancies in your NAP information, it could lead to a poor user experience, and you might lose potential customers.
  • Boosts Credibility and Trust: Inconsistent or inaccurate NAP details can harm your business’s credibility. Search engines may not trust your business if they detect discrepancies in your information across different platforms. This can result in lower rankings, making it difficult for potential customers to find you. A well-managed NAP profile strengthens the reputation of your business, enhancing trust with both search engines and customers.

How to Optimize NAP SEO

To optimize NAP SEO effectively, follow these best practices:

  • Ensure NAP Consistency Across All Platforms: Make sure that your business name, address, and phone number are consistent across your website, Google Business Profile, social media pages, online directories (such as Yelp, Yellow Pages), and other relevant platforms. The information should be identical in terms of spelling, abbreviations, and format (e.g., “Street” vs. “St.” or “Avenue” vs. “Ave.”).
  • Update NAP Information Regularly: If your business undergoes any changes, such as a new location or updated phone number, update the NAP details on all platforms promptly. Neglecting to do so can lead to confusion and harm your local SEO efforts.
  • Use Structured Data Markup (Schema.org): Implementing structured data markup on your website helps search engines understand your NAP information better. Schema markup provides search engines with clear and structured details about your business, which can improve local search rankings.
  • Claim and Verify Online Listings: Claim your business listings on major directories and ensure the information is correct. Verified listings are given more weight by search engines, which can positively impact your local search visibility.
  • Monitor and Fix Inconsistent Citations: Regularly audit your online citations to identify any discrepancies in your NAP information. Use tools like Moz Local, BrightLocal, or Yext to find and fix inconsistencies across various online directories.
  • Optimize Your Google Business Profile (GBP): Your Google Business Profile plays a significant role in local SEO. Make sure your NAP information is accurate and up-to-date, and provide additional details such as business hours, services offered, and customer reviews to enhance your profile’s completeness.

Common NAP SEO Mistakes to Avoid

  • Using Multiple Phone Numbers: Stick to one primary phone number for your business to avoid confusion. Using different phone numbers across different platforms can negatively impact your NAP consistency.
  • Not Updating NAP Information After a Move: If your business relocates, failing to update your NAP details promptly can result in incorrect citations. This can mislead customers and harm your local search rankings.
  • Ignoring Duplicate Listings: Having duplicate business listings with different NAP information can confuse search engines and potential customers. Make sure to merge or remove any duplicate listings.

Comprehending Mobile Home Lots

A mobile home lot is a parcel particularly designated for positioning a manufactured or mobile home. These lots are generally found in mobile home parks or areas yet can likewise be standalone homes. When buying a mobile home lot, customers get ownership of the land, which can be a more cost-efficient option contrasted to leasing a great deal in a mobile home park.

Considerations When Getting a Mobile Home Lot

Area

The place of the whole lot is essential. Aspects to take into consideration consist of proximity to schools, shopping centers, medical care centers, and job opportunity. Furthermore, the general desirability of the area can influence the whole lot’s long-lasting value.

Zoning and Laws

Customers ought to completely look into regional zoning laws and laws. Some locations have constraints on the kind, size, or age of mobile homes that can be put on the lot. Comprehending these policies is vital to prevent potential legal problems in the future.

Utilities and Infrastructure

Make certain that the lot has access to needed utilities such as water, electricity, and sewer. Some country whole lots may require extra investments for well and septic systems.

Whole Lot Size and Design

Take into consideration the size and layout of the lot. It ought to be huge sufficient to accommodate your mobile home easily, with area for enhancements, car parking, and exterior living areas if wanted.

Community Policy

If the lot is part of a mobile home area, evaluate the neighborhood regulations and laws. These may include constraints on pet dogs, site visitors, or home alterations.

Block paving driveways

Block paving is based around interlocking, which gives you further toughness. It can be designed in a range of patterns and you can simply replace individual blocks if they are damaged. One other key benefit of block paving driveways is that they have great fade protection. A block paving private drive can last for up to 20 years. These private drives do not require top polishing, and there is typically no need to repaint them even years down the line. All you usually need to do to maintain a block paving private drive is to clean it with soap and water. Block paving driveways are also popular due to the way that they can withstand harsh weather with ease.

Resin-bound plus resin-bonded private drives

Resin-bound and resin-bonded private drives have become increasingly well-known over recent years. Resin-bound private drives are water-permeable. Whilst resin-bonded systems have resin spread across the surface with loose stone scattered on top of them, resin and stone are mixed together and shovelled into place to produce resin-bound systems. These systems give you a great deal of choice when it comes to versatility and colour.

Indian stone private drives

Indian stone private drives offer the look of natural sandstone, and there are plenty of patterns and colours to choose from. One of the key benefits of Indian Sandstone is that it doesn’t typically split, crack or peel. This stone also has non-slip qualities.

Stone private drives

Stone driveways are quick and easy to install and may be the ideal option if you’re on a budget plan. A big advantage of having a stone private drive installed is that you’ll be alerted when someone pulls up on your drive or walks across it. This means it can be a great deterrent for intruders. These private drives also require little maintenance.

Cobblestone and brick private drives

Despite the fact that they’re not as well-liked as they once were, cobblestone and brick private drives offer a highly unique, attractive appeal. These driveways offer good protection to freezing and are straightforward to take care of. They are also noted for their durability and can be personalized to your particular requirements and preferences.

Pattern-imprinted cement driveways.

Pattern-imprinted concrete driveways are also known as stamped concrete and decorative concrete private drives. These driveways offer a highly long lasting surface and can easily hold up against heavy weights. Another reason why these driveways are so popular is that they require minimal upkeep. There are many designs, styles, colours and patterns to choose from.
